  1. Justin Donta Brownlee (born April 23, 1988) is an American-Filipino professional basketball player for Pelita Jaya Bakrie of the Indonesian Basketball League (IBL). Brownlee is widely regarded as one of the best import's of the Philippine Basketball Association (PBA).
